    Default Lost (Season 2) - Episode 19: S.O.S.

    Discuss last nights E4 episode of Lost here (22/08/2006):

    Quote Synopsis = Lost (Season 2) - Episode 19: S.O.S. wrote:
    Rose is surprisingly and vehemently opposed to Bernard's plan to create an S.O.S. signal; romantic sparks are rekindled between Jack and Kate when they trek into the jungle to propose a "trade" with "The Others"; and Locke begins to question his faith in the island.
